Christmas 2018 Stags in the snow Polymer stamps from the Holiday Seasons set Double stamps mounted onto the acrylic block for quicker printing Clear wax (No.27) and Cyan Blue (No.46) Ironed onto the dry stamped images Mountains put in using the iron’s tip pointed end A platform of solidity for the reindeer to stand upon The basic image before any snow falls! Well, lots of them …. Flicking off molten white wax using a natural hair brush Resting the brush head on the iron between cards keeps it warm and ready to go Blizzard conditions in places! Encaustic Art Wax Sealer onto a fabric pad (old teeshirt) Spread the sealer all over the waxed image
Finish with dabbing up and down to avoid any marks when it driesNice even coating of sealer Adds a layer of protective acrylic to the surface All done and drying out (about an hour) Peeling off double sided tape on the inner panel of the aperture card Position the card adn stick into place Finished one!
